Property Overview:
128 Stanford Way is a condominium unit in Sausalito, CA, built in 1981. It features 2 bedrooms, 1 bathroom, and 660 sq. ft. of living space. The home includes in-unit laundry, a cozy fireplace, central heating, and covered parking. The estimated home value is $650,700.
